Launching a project can be an exciting journey, but it often requires significant financial resources to bring your vision to life. Fortunately, there are diverse avenues available for acquiring the funds you need to attain success.
One popular approach is crowdfunding, which involves soliciting contributions from a wide number of individuals online. Platforms like Kickstarter and Indiegogo offer a space for you to present your project to the world and attract potential backers. Another avenue is seeking out grants from foundations or government agencies that align with your project's goals. These organizations often allocate funding to innovative initiatives that serve society.

This Regulation Works with Equity Crowdfunding
Equity crowdfunding has revolutionized the way businesses raise capital, providing an avenue for startups and small enterprises to tap into a wider pool of investors. Within this landscape, Regulation A+ stands out as a powerful tool that complements the equity crowdfunding process. By enabling companies the opportunity to raise significant amounts of capital from the public while adhering to strict regulatory guidelines, Regulation A+ has become a popular choice for businesses seeking to expand their operations and achieve their goals .
- Here's how Regulation A+ functions within the framework of equity crowdfunding:
- Initially , Reg A+ allows companies to raise up to five hundred million dollars in capital from a broad range of investors. This elevated ceiling compared to traditional equity crowdfunding platforms makes it a viable option for businesses with large-scale funding needs.
- Moreover , companies that utilize Reg A+ are required to submit a detailed offering circular with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). This rigorous framework helps to safeguard capital by providing them with in-depth details about the company, its financials, and the risks associated with the investment.
Regulation A+ has become as a significant advantage for businesses seeking to raise capital through equity crowdfunding. By offering companies access to a wider pool of investors and ensuring a transparent regulatory framework, Reg A+ fosters a robust ecosystem for both startups and the individual investors who contribute to their growth.

Fundrise Reg A Offering
Fundrise is popular among investors platform that offers alternative investment opportunities. One such opportunity is the Fundrise Reg A+ Offering, which allows investors to invest in commercial real estate investments with relatively low minimums. The offerings typically feature a diverse portfolio of properties across the United States, and Fundrise provides regular updates and performance reports to its investors.

Regulation A+ Offerings
Regulation A+ offerings, often simply referred to as Reg A+, offer a unique pathway for companies pursuing capital through the public markets. This framework allows smaller businesses to raise up to $50 million in a single offering, becoming a viable alternative to traditional IPOs.
The SEC introduced Reg A+ in 2015 as a method to boost capital formation for smaller companies relaxing the regulatory hurdles. As this structure, companies {can tap into a wider pool of investors exterior to their immediate networks.
- Important advantages of Reg A+ offerings comprise:
- Reduced regulatory requirements compared versus traditional IPOs.
- A broader investor base
- Higher market visibility
